Могу про мой сервис
https://dropmail.me/ рассказать.
Написан он на Erlang. Содержит в себе SMTP сервер
https://github.com/Vagabond/gen_smtp и HTTP сервер
https://github.com/ninenines/cowboy в одном Erlang демоне.
Пользователь заходит на страничку сайта, подключается по websocket к серверу. Сервер генерирует ему уникальный email адрес (уникальность поддерживается хранящимся в памяти счетчиком) и отправляет этот адрес клиенту по websocket. Так же этот адрес записывается в таблицу в памяти демона, в которой хранится соответствие Email <-> Websocket.
Когда на SMTP сервер приходит письмо, он первым делом ищет в этой таблице по email получателя его вебсокет. Не находит - отказывается принимать письмо. Находит - отправляет письмо в вебсокет.
Но никто не запрещает сохранять это письмо где-то даже если в таблице ничего не нашлось.
Знаю так же, что на темпмейл.ру используется SMTP сервер
https://github.com/haraka/Haraka